3:3 AND HE SHALL SIT AS A REFINER
AND PURIFIER OF SILVER: AND HE
SHALL PURIFY THE SONS OF LEVI, AND
PURGE THEM AS GOLD AND SILVER, THAT
THEY MAY OFFER UNTO THE LORD AN
OFFERING IN RIGHTEOUSNESS.
Like priest, like people. It is a fact,
hardly with exception, that no people will
rise above the righteousness of their
leaders. God concentrates His purge upon the
priests - once purified they will convey that
purity to the people.

3:14 YE HAVE SAID, IT IS VAIN TO
SERVE GOD: AND WHAT PROFIT IS IT
THAT WE HAVE KEPT HIS ORDINANCE, AND
THAT WE HAVE WALKED MOURNFULLY
BEFORE THE LORD OF HOSTS?
God accommodates them. He tells them what
they said. They have found fault with the Liberal Philosophy
way of life they were taught, they complained
of three things. 1) "What profit." They
found no benefits in obedience. 2) "That we
kept His ordinance." They became
uncomfortable and incompatible with the moral
laws of God. 3) "That we have walked mourn-
fully." "Let's have a happy, position
religion. This serious life of holy precepts Charismatic Lightness
and separation was wrongly taught by our
praying fathers. Let's live 'before'
ourselves and drop this 'fear' religion."
